What the day will look like In this varied role, you will handle the routine management of captive insurance client portfolios. You will ensure excellent client service and deliver their insurance programmes effectively. You will work closely with senior client partners and internal colleagues, gaining exposure to financial reporting, regulatory compliance, company secretarial work, and the strategic development of captive solutions. Key activities include: Owning the day-to-day insurance servicing and renewals for a portfolio of captive clients, ensuring all Aon Guernsey and client deadlines are met Reviewing all insurance-related matters for client Board and Committee meeting packs and communicating insurance topics at Board and Underwriting Committee meetings Drafting and reviewing meeting minutes and reviewing contract wordings to ensure insurance programmes are fit for purpose and aligned with relevant regulatory and legislative requirements Developing excellent working relationships with key partners including clients, colleagues, regulators, insurers and brokers, and keeping clients abreast of relevant developments in Aon and the global insurance markets Working closely with the Client Services Director/Client Executive and wider team to achieve both AIM and client goals, contributing to budgetary objectives and supporting projects or ad hoc work as required Providing and/or reviewing timely insurance and claims information for finance colleagues in preparation of management accounts Actively handling, supporting, and developing staff reporting to you and contributing to the training and education of the wider team How this opportunity is different This is an opportunity to join an expanding captive management team in one of the world’s leading captive domiciles, working with large multinational clients on sophisticated risk financing structures.
